Subwoofer output distorted

Check to see if the speaker foam surrounds have disintegrated on your subwoofer. I bet it is. If so the speaker will sound like it is distorting or vibrating. Electrically it should be fine. My 2000 Avalon has this same problem with the 8" JBL subwoofer. It is a common problem and an easy fix. Go online to ebay or Amazon and purchase a speaker foam surround replacement kit (Ranges from $18.00 to $25). Youtube also has "How To" videos on how to repair this on your own. 2005 toyota avalon overheated and now it will not

Is it turning over or is it locked up - check to see if your can turn it over by hand- serious overheating can ruin an engine permanently. It can melt critical wiring as well. For many of the 90's and 2000's Toyota various models - Camry, Tacoma, 4 Runners, Corolla, and some other models it is usually caused by temperature sensitive fan switch on the radiator not operating. Electric fan on the radiator should operate when temp above 200 degrees. Less often the control relay 90987-03003 is defective. Check if bubbling in the radiator smells like exhaust. That would indicate a blown head gasket. A jumper wire from your marker light positive to the lower contact in the fan control relay socket will operate your fan when parking lights are on. The larger vehicles with more powerful radiator fans will need a hefty jumper from a headlight positive to avoid overheating the lighting wiring. Make sure the engine is off and warmed up to check the radiator core with your hand to see if it is getting circulation. If it is all cold the thermostat might be stuck.

2005 Toyota Avalon with codes p0441,p0455,p0456,p0505 and the vcs abs and traction light on?

You have a few different things coming up as these lights and codes. I'll list the code meaning below. Did you mean the VSC light? VSC, Traction Control and ABS all refer to your braking system so get it fixed AS SOON AS POSSIBLE! The '505' code refers to the air flow management system in the air intake manifold. The other codes refer to the EVAP system on the vehicle. This may seem a silly suggestion but check you fuel filler cap isn't loose, missing or the seal on the cap isn't damaged. The EVAP works as an air tight system and if it is leaking that is one of the most common causes, (and its a cheap repair). P0441 = Evaporative Emission System Incorrect Purge Flow P0455 = Evaporative Emission System Leak Detected (large leak) P0456 = Evaporative Emission System Leak Detected (very small leak) P0505 = Idle Air Control System

Toyota avalon 2006 key fob apparently doesn't work

It looks like you have the "Smart Key" (a small rectangular box) that does not look like a traditional key.
What you also have is a dead battery inside the Smart Key.
Look closely at the box; there is a little button on the side. Press it. This will release a small hidden key. After you remove the small key, use a small flat blade screwdriver to pry the case of the box open at the slot provided. Take the unit to a store that sells miniature batteries, and have it replaced. You will NOT have to reprogram it after the battery is changed. The life span of the miniature batteries is roughly 20 months, less if exposed to RFI, like sitting on a TV, a monitor, or other electrical device. The Smart key TRANSMITS all of the time, even when you do not press the buttons. This is why the battery only lasts 18-20 months. Let me know if this fixes your issue..
